The Sea to Summit Spark Ultralight Down Sleeping Bag is designed for those who want a lightweight yet warm option for cool weather camping, rated to keep you comfortable down to 15°F (-9°C). Its 850+ fill power goose down insulated with a moisture-resistant treatment helps maintain warmth even in damp conditions, which is a big plus if you camp in areas where humidity or light moisture is a concern. The mummy shape is contoured to fit your body snugly but still allows natural sleeping positions, making it comfortable without unnecessary bulk.
Weighing just under 2 pounds and packing down small, it’s great for backpackers and bike packers who need to save space and reduce weight. The fabric is a thin but durable nylon treated to resist water on the outside, and the breathable nylon liner feels soft against the skin for all-night comfort. The full box baffles construction helps keep the down evenly spread, so you won’t have cold spots.
The slim fit and ultralight materials might feel a bit snug or less cushioned for those who prefer a roomier or more padded sleeping bag. While rated for 5 seasons, it’s best suited for spring to early fall conditions rather than extreme winter cold. Its lifetime warranty adds confidence in durability. If you are looking for a compact, warm, and comfortable sleeping bag for moderate cold and value quality materials and packability, this Sea to Summit model is a solid choice.

The Kelty Cosmic 20 Down Mummy Sleeping Bag is a popular choice for backpackers and campers seeking comfort and sustainability. It features a 550 fill power down insulation, which offers good compressibility and warmth for its weight, making it suitable for temperatures as low as 20 degrees Fahrenheit. The mummy shape is designed to provide warmth and comfort by snugly fitting the body, although some may find it restrictive compared to other shapes.
The sleeping bag is designed for adults up to 6' 6" in height, making it versatile for various users. It is also lightweight, with a total weight of about 2 lbs. 6 oz for the regular size, and packs down to a relatively small size (13 x 7 inches), which is ideal for backpacking and easy transport. Additional features include dual direction zippers for convenience and a PFAS-free durable water repellent finish that aligns with eco-friendly practices.
The use of recycled fabrics and ethically sourced down further highlights Kelty's commitment to sustainability. However, the 550 fill power, while adequate, is not as high as some premium sleeping bags, which might be a consideration for those needing extra warmth in extremely cold conditions. In summary, the Kelty Cosmic 20 is a well-rounded sleeping bag that balances comfort, sustainability, and practicality, making it a sound choice for most campers and backpackers.

The Teton Fahrenheit Mammoth is a roomy double sleeping bag designed for comfort and warmth in 3-season camping, rated down to 0°F. Its rectangular shape and large size (94x62 inches) make it longer and wider than a queen mattress, which is great if you need extra space or are camping with a partner or family member. Inside, it features a soft cotton flannel lining that feels cozy against the skin, while the polyester taffeta outer shell adds durability. The insulation uses cotton fiber fill, which provides decent warmth but is heavier and bulkier compared to synthetic or down alternatives, reflected in the bag’s weight of about 16.5 pounds. This means it isn't the lightest or most packable option for backpacking but works well for car camping or base camps where weight isn’t a big concern.
The sleeping bag includes thoughtful features like dual zippers on the sides and bottom for easy access and ventilation, draft tubes to keep warm air inside, and hang loops to maintain loft when stored. It also comes with a sturdy compression sack to help reduce packed size, although it remains on the heavier side. The bag supports users up to nearly 8 feet tall, which suits most adults comfortably.
One thing to consider is that while the cotton insulation offers natural comfort, it may not perform as well in very wet conditions compared to synthetic fills. For those seeking a warm, spacious, and comfortable sleeping bag primarily for cold-weather, family, or couple camping, the Teton Mammoth offers a solid balance of warmth, size, and usability, especially if you don’t mind carrying a bit more weight.
